Westminster, CA – UPDATE: Eduardo Hernandez Killed in Crash Caused by Fleeing Suspect at Newland St & Westminster Ave

Westminster, CA (December 21, 2022) – On Friday morning, December 16, one person died, and another was injured in a violent crash following a police attempt to initiate a traffic stop.

According to the Orange County Sheriff’s Department, the accident occurred at the intersection of Newland Street and Westminster Avenue in Westminster when Westminster police were attempting to execute a traffic stop. The incident began as the police attempted to pull over a Camaro for fraudulent tags, but the vehicle did not stop, sped down the street, and ran a red light at Trask Avenue, crashing into a BMW heading east. The driver of the BMW was ejected from his vehicle. The driver of the Camaro, 29-year-old Fred Harper Jr., continued to flee from the police and the scene of the accident

Emergency personnel was immediately called to the scene. Paramedics and firefighters responded quickly and tended to those injured. The driver of the BMW, a 64-year-old man, suffered very serious injuries and died at the scene of the crash. He was later identified as Eduardo Hernandez of Stanton. A 54-year-old male passenger also suffered very serious injuries and was transported to a local hospital, where he is listed in critical but stable condition.

Westminster and Garden Grove police departments searched the area for the driver, that fled the scene. The driver was eventually found mid-afternoon and was arrested. He was charged with several felony charges, including second-degree murder, driving under the influence of drugs, and hit-and-run causing death and injury. The circumstances surrounding the accident are under further investigation by local authorities.

Fatal DUI Accidents in California

Most people will be pulled over by a police officer at some point in their life. When that happens, the law states that you must pull your vehicle to the side of the road as soon as safely possible. While most traffic stops are for minor traffic infractions, some traffic stops are for more serious violations or criminal investigations. Traffic stops are an important investigative and crime-stopping tool used by police officers. When criminal activity is afoot, what may seem like a simple traffic stop can quickly escalate into a more serious situation as the criminal tries to flee and evade the police.

Reckless driving is a very serious problem on the country’s roadways. When reckless driving is coupled with criminal behaviors and fleeing law enforcement, the chances of accidents occurring with a very serious injury or fatal outcome increase exponentially. Drunk driving is the pinnacle of reckless driving behavior and shows a blatant disregard for the well-being of others. Many people are seriously injured or tragically killed in DUI accidents each year. These types of accidents can be especially upsetting because they could have been so easily avoided by following the laws regarding drinking and driving.
